开源软件已成为全球软件产业的重要支柱。开源网站作为开源项目的展示与交流平台,对于推动开源技术的发展具有重要意义。开源网站的维护并非易事,需要我们付出持续的努力。本文将从开源网站维护的重要性、面临的挑战以及应对策略等方面进行探讨。
一、开源网站维护的重要性
1. 促进开源项目的发展
开源网站作为开源项目的展示窗口,有助于吸引更多开发者关注和参与。通过维护一个高质量的开源网站,可以提升项目的知名度和影响力,从而吸引更多人才和资源投入其中。
2. 保障开源项目的稳定运行
开源网站提供项目文档、下载链接、社区交流等功能,对于开源项目的稳定运行具有重要意义。良好的网站维护可以确保项目信息的准确性和及时性,降低项目出现问题的风险。
3. 提高用户体验
一个优秀的开源网站可以为用户提供便捷的服务,如搜索、下载、提问等。通过维护网站,提高网站性能和稳定性,有助于提升用户体验,增强用户对项目的信任度。
二、开源网站维护面临的挑战
1. 资源匮乏
开源网站维护需要一定的技术、人力和资金支持。许多开源项目由于规模较小,难以吸引足够资源投入网站维护。
2. 技术更新迅速
互联网技术日新月异,开源网站需要不断更新技术以适应时代发展。技术更新需要投入大量人力和物力,对于开源项目来说是一个不小的挑战。
3. 安全风险
开源网站面临黑客攻击、恶意代码等安全风险。一旦网站遭受攻击,可能导致项目信息泄露、项目崩溃等问题。
三、开源网站维护的应对策略
1. 建立完善的维护团队
开源网站维护需要专业团队的支持。可以招募志愿者、寻求企业赞助等方式,组建一支具备丰富经验的维护团队。
2. 制定合理的维护计划
根据网站实际情况,制定详细的维护计划,包括技术更新、内容更新、安全防护等方面。定期对维护计划进行评估和调整。
3. 加强社区建设
开源网站维护离不开社区的支持。通过举办线上线下的活动,增强开发者之间的交流与合作,共同维护网站。
4. 引入商业化模式
对于一些具有商业潜力的开源项目,可以尝试引入商业化模式,为网站维护提供资金支持。
开源网站维护是推动开源技术发展的重要环节。面对资源匮乏、技术更新迅速、安全风险等挑战,我们需要不断创新、完善维护策略。只有守护好这扇创新之门,才能让开源技术在互联网时代焕发出更加耀眼的光芒。